Maggie Segall Speaks at the ABA’s “Cartels and Coordinated Effects: Mergers in Markets with Past Conduct” Webinar

December 11, 2020

On December 11, 2020, Cravath partner Margaret T. Segall spoke during the American Bar Association’s “Cartels and Coordinated Effects: Mergers in Markets with Past Conduct” webinar, which was hosted by the ABA’s Antitrust Law Section. Maggie and her fellow panelists examined the impact of past criminal antirust conduct on merger analysis, the interaction between cartel enforcement and merger enforcement, and how the coordinated conduct of merging parties and other market participants can effect merger reviews.
